Your Expenses
When you’re running a business, you need to keep track of your expenses. Not knowing how much your company is spending can cause potential damage to your company. Expenses are necessary costs that it takes to run your business. You need to pay for a business space, a website domain, a payment portal, the acquisition of your products, and more. These expenses allow you to run your business, but if you don’t keep track of your expenses, you can end up spending too much and damage your bottom line. Spending too much on expenses puts your business in the red. If your expenses outweigh your profits, you’ll continue to go deeper and deeper into debt until you’re forced to close your business. Keeping track of your expenses keeps you on top of all your business’ finances.
Profits
Your profits are another big number to keep track of within your business. Your profits allow you to continue to pay for and run your business, and provide a livelihood for yourself and your employees. To find your profits, subtract your various expenses from your revenue. Any remaining funds are the profits you’ve made from the sale. You should also understand the difference between profitability and profit. Profit is a fixed amount. You’ll know the exact amount that you received to pay your employees and yourself. However, profitability is an estimation of the profit your business can receive in relation to its size.
